Ashton Kutcher mentioned he’s “fortunate to be alive” after affected by a uncommon illness that left him unable to see, hear or stroll.
Kutcher revealed his battle with vasculitis, an autoimmune dysfunction, for the primary time in an episode of Operating Wild with Bear Grylls: The Problem, which airs on Nationwide Geographic.
Within the episode, Grylls requested Kutcher the place his power comes from, to which the actor responded: “Two years in the past, I had this bizarre, tremendous uncommon type of vasculitis that, like, knocked out my imaginative and prescient. It knocked out my listening to. It knocked out, like, all my equilibrium.”
Kutcher, 44, mentioned it took him a couple of 12 months to regain his senses and stability once more.
“You don’t actually recognize it till it’s gone, till you go, ‘I don’t know if I’m ever going to have the ability to see once more, I don’t know if I’m ever going to have the ability to hear once more, I don’t know if I’m ever going to have the ability to stroll once more,’” he says.
Actor-director Harold Ramis died from vasculitis issues in 2014. The Caddyshack, Nationwide Lampoon’s Trip and Groundhog Day director suffered from the illness for 4 years earlier than dying at 69.
Kutcher added on the finish of the interview: “The minute you begin seeing your obstacles as issues which are made for you, to provide you what you want, then life begins to get enjoyable, proper? You begin browsing on high of your issues as a substitute of dwelling beneath them.”

What’s vasculitis?
Vasculitis is a household of uncommon illnesses that causes irritation of the blood vessels, in keeping with the Mayo Clinic. The irritation then restricts blood move, which can lead to organ and tissue harm and even an aneurysm. If an aneurysm bursts, it might trigger inside bleeding and loss of life.
Common signs of vasculitis embody fever, complications, fatigue, weight reduction and aches and pains. If the sickness progresses, extra extreme signs can embody blindness, listening to loss, ulcers, dizziness, bleeding beneath the pores and skin and shortness of breath.
“The precise reason behind vasculitis isn’t totally understood,” the Mayo Clinic writes. “Some varieties are associated to an individual’s genetic make-up. Others end result from the immune system attacking blood vessel cells by mistake.”

Vasculitis can have an effect on anybody however age, household historical past, drug use and previous medical issues can improve one’s chance of contracting the illness.
A research revealed in Nature discovered that big cell arteritis (GCA) is the commonest type of vasculitis in aged individuals, and it mostly impacts individuals of Northern European ancestry.
In Ontario, GCA affected round 235 individuals per 100,000 in 2018, up from 125 individuals per 100,000 in 2000.

Kawasaki illness is the commonest type of vasculitis in youngsters aged round 5 years previous, and the research discovered that it mostly impacts youngsters of Southeast Asian ancestry.
In Canada, about 20 youngsters per 100,000 endure from Kawasaki illness.
It’s unclear what type of vasculitis Kutcher suffers from.
